NGINXセキュリティ設定を徹底チェック!脆弱性診断ツールを使った実践ガイド

ウェブサーバーとして広く採用されているnginxは、セキュリティ設定を適切に行わないと、重大な脆弱性を露呈する可能性があります。特に、古いバージョンの使用や設定の不備は、外部からの攻撃を誘発する可能性があるため、定期的なセキュリティチェックが必要となります。本稿では、nginxのセキュリティ設定を徹底的にチェックする方法を紹介します。脆弱性診断ツールを利用して、nginxの設定ファイルや、
SSL/TLSの設定、認証やアクセス制御に関する潜在的なリスクを洗い出し、安全で安定したウェブサーバーの運用を実現するための実践的なガイドを提供します。
NGINXセキュリティ設定を徹底チェック!脆弱性診断ツールを使った実践ガイド
NGINXサーバーのセキュリティ設定を徹底的にチェックするには、脆弱性診断ツールを使用することが効果的です。このガイドでは、NGINXセキュリティ設定をチェックする際の手順と、脆弱性診断ツールの使い方を解説します。
NGINXの基本的なセキュリティ設定
NGINXの基本的なセキュリティ設定には、ファイアウォール設定、HTTPSの設定、HTTPヘッダーの設定などがあります。これらの設定を適切に行うことで、サーバーのセキュリティを向上させることができます。 ファイアウォール設定:ファイアウォールを設定し、不正アクセスを防止します。 HTTPSの設定:HTTPSを使用して、通信データを暗号化します。 HTTPヘッダーの設定:HTTPヘッダーを設定し、セキュリティ関連の情報を伝達します。
脆弱性診断ツールの使い方
脆弱性診断ツールは、サーバーの脆弱性を自動的に診断するツールです。このツールを使用することで、サーバーのセキュリティ設定に隙がないかどうかを確認することができます。 脆弱性診断ツールのインストール:脆弱性診断ツールをインストールします。 脆弱性診断ツールの設定:脆弱性診断ツールを設定し、診断設定を行います。 脆弱性診断ツールの実行:脆弱性診断ツールを実行し、診断結果を確認します。
NGINXのセキュリティ設定をチェックする
NGINXのセキュリティ設定をチェックするには、以下の手順を実行します。 1. NGINXの設定ファイルを確認します。 2. サーバーのファイアウォール設定を確認します。 3. HTTPSの設定を確認します。 4. HTTPヘッダーの設定を確認します。
セキュリティ設定の変更
NGINXのセキュリティ設定を変更するには、以下の手順を実行します。 1. NGINXの設定ファイルを変更します。 2. サーバーのファイアウォール設定を変更します。 3. HTTPSの設定を変更します。 4. HTTPヘッダーの設定を変更します。
変更後のセキュリティ設定を確認する
変更後のセキュリティ設定を確認するには、以下の手順を実行します。 1. NGINXの設定ファイルを確認します。 2. サーバーのファイアウォール設定を確認します。 3. HTTPSの設定を確認します。 4. HTTPヘッダーの設定を確認します。
| 設定項目 | 設定値 |
|---|---|
| ファイアウォール設定 | 有効 |
| HTTPSの設定 | 有効 |
| HTTPヘッダーの設定 | 有効 |
よくある質問
NGINXのセキュリティ設定を徹底チェックすることの重要性は何ですか。
セキュリティ設定を徹底チェックすることは、サイバー攻撃やデータ漏洩を防ぐために非常に重要です。NGINXの設定には、セキュリティに関する多くのオプションが含まれており、適切に設定しない場合、脆弱性を生じさせてしまいます。セキュリティ設定を徹底チェックすることで、これらの脆弱性を特定し、対策を講じることができます。また、コンプライアンスを維持するために、セキュリティ設定を徹底チェックすることは必須です。
NGINXのセキュリティ診断ツールはどのような特徴がありますか。
NGINXのセキュリティ診断ツールは、脆弱性の自動検出や設定の分析など、多くの特徴があります。これらのツールを使用することで、手作業での設定の確認が不要になり、時間と労力を節約できます。また、設定の問題やセキュリティ上のリスクを特定し、対策を講じることができます。さらに、レポートの自動生成など、報告書作成なども自動化できます。
NGINXのセキュリティ設定を徹底チェックするための実践ガイドはどのようなステップを踏むべきですか。
NGINXのセキュリティ設定を徹底チェックするための実践ガイドは、設定の確認、脆弱性の検出、対策の講じ、定期的なチェックなど、適切なステップを踏むべきです。まず、設定を確認し、不正設定や不必要な設定を特定します。次に、脆弱性診断ツールを使用して、設定の問題やセキュリティ上のリスクを特定します。さらに、対策を講じ、設定を修正します。最後に、定期的なチェックを実施し、設定の問題やセキュリティ上のリスクを継続的に特定し、対策を講じます。
NGINXのセキュリティ設定を徹底チェックすることを怠った場合の影響の例はありますか。
NGINXのセキュリティ設定を徹底チェックすることを怠った場合、データ漏洩やサーバー停止など、深刻な影響を及ぼす可能性があります。たとえば、不正設定により、권限が不正に昇格し、データが不正に読み取られる可能性があります。また、脆弱性を悪用され、マルウェアやランサムウェアが感染する可能性があります。これらの影響は、組織の評判や財務に大きな損害を与える可能性があります。





